Roca Corbatera Summit

Highlight • Summit

On the cliffs of Cornudella de Montsant we find the Roca Corbatera, the highest point of the Serra de Montsant, with an altitude of 1,163 m. Priorat county roof.
Peak included in the list of the 100 peaks of the F.E.E.C.


It is an idyllic place from where you can enjoy a vast territory and, on clear days, you can even see the Pyrenees and the island of Mallorca.

La Llibreria Crevice (807 m)

Highlight • Gorge

Slit that presents the cliff separating the wall, very narrow at the beginning that makes us have to contort bravely to pass. Then it becomes wider and finally turns right and when it seems that we can no longer continue we can overcome a block and very carefully go down the other side to the road.

La Figuera Summit (580 m)

Highlight • Summit

La Figuera 580 meters is the highest point of the route. You have to be careful with the descent towards El Molà as it is a very fast stretch. luckily they are roads that have virtually no vehicles.
From the top of La Figuera, the views are spectacular. You can even see the village of Ascó (Ribera d'Ebre) and the cooling tower of the nuclear power plant.

Punta Pericana (1,047 m)

Highlight • Summit

The summit can only be reached via a wall with chains, but the climb is worth it because of the panoramic view of the Serra de Montsant.
